Less than one minute into the biggest game in Spanish football so far this season, with Atletico Madrid taking on cross-city rivals Real Madrid in the UEFA Super Cup, and there has already been a goal.
One of the more controversial players in football, Diego Costa, smashed the Europa League winners in front with an impeccably-taken strike.
With the ball dropping down from quite a height towards the edge of the box, Spain international Costa headed the ball over Real's defence and managed to get around the outside of both Rafael Varane and Sergio Ramos.
Reaching the by-line before either defender could get a foot on the ball, Costa unleashed a dangerous strike across Keylor Navas' goal with his right foot, which nestled in the top corner of the Costa Rican's goal.
An unbelievable start with the Champions League winners already behind, Atleti lead 1-0!
